Chapter 107: First Explanation of Qingyuan Continent

Qin Fengming has only been cultivating immortality for a few years and is not very familiar with things in the immortal world.

Of course, such a large sect would not only have middle- and low-level cultivation techniques.

As long as a monk in the Luoxia Sect successfully builds the foundation, he will receive a middle-grade cultivation technique from the sect. If his cultivation qualifications are excellent, it is possible to obtain a high-grade immortality cultivation technique.

It's just that those good exercises are not placed here.

Qin Fengming exited the room and came to the 'Item Refining' room. He found that this room had many more secret books than the previous room. There were dozens of them.

I picked up a book and flipped through it, and it turned out that it was an article about weapon refining experience written by a senior, but there was very little written about the weapon refining techniques. I picked up a few more books, and the contents were basically the same.

Although some of them are the experience of refining spiritual weapons, which are of great use to him, at this time, he will not waste it on refining weapons. Because refining spiritual weapons requires the cultivation of the foundation period, and he must be able to control the numbers at the same time while being distracted.

Ten kinds of materials, but he can't do it at this moment.

The 'talisman making' room is also mostly about the experience of some seniors making talismans. Although there are some about talisman spells, they are all elementary talismans. There are several intermediate and advanced talisman introductions, but they are limited to names and powers.

It seems that for the masters of talisman making, talismans are extremely important and are generally not taught to outsiders. Each advanced talisman is a secret that is not taught. Unless someone is particularly close to him, no one else can expect to be taught it.

Afterwards, he came to the 'alchemy' room and saw that the huge room was also empty, with only twenty or thirty books placed on the bookshelves.

Qin Fengming smiled unconsciously, and after taking a closer look, he found that there was only one Huang Jing Dan prescription available, and the others were the experience of his seniors in alchemy. He studied the Huang Jing Dan prescription over and over again, silently remembering it in his heart, and the contents introduced in it

Although there are more than ten kinds of medicinal herbal materials, they can usually be found in the market. I want to go back and try them out.

Finally, he entered the 'Formation' room. The main purpose of his trip was to find books on formation. He walked in with high hopes. After taking a closer look, he felt disappointed. Although it was not as shabby as the 'Alchemy' room, it was not much different.

.

There were only about thirty books on the bookshelf. He looked through them one by one. After a meal, he had read the last one. Although he was not disappointed, he was not happy at all.

Among them, only a few books introduced formation refining, and they were all the most basic formations. The others were just some experiences. Even so, Qin Fengming was very happy. After thinking about it for a while, he chose one of the books.

After that, he carefully checked other experience books and selected one. He turned around and walked out of the room.

Just when he was about to turn around and go back, he suddenly saw the word "Anecdotes" written on the innermost room. He was shocked. For Qin Fengming, who was new to the world of immortality, studying the anecdotes of the world of immortality was a big deal.

It was very helpful to him. He turned around and quickly walked into the room.

I saw three bookshelves in the room filled with books, hundreds of volumes in total.

He walked forward and picked up a book at random, and found that it was what a senior saw and heard when he traveled in the mountains. Looking at the book in his hand, Qin Fengming couldn't help but feel happy. This kind of book was exactly what he needed.

He quickly checked the books on the bookshelf one by one. Most of them were about the seniors' own personal experiences, and some were about various rumors.

After repeated comparisons, he finally selected a classic called "Qingyuan Continental Travels".

The author of this book is a senior who is in the stage of becoming an elixir. When he had no hope of transforming into an infant, he resolutely gave up cultivation and traveled alone in Qingyuan Continent for more than ten years. He recorded everything he saw and heard along the way, and finally summarized it into

The book is kept in the Luoxia Sect.

Qin Fengming picked it up, excitedly came to the old man, bowed and saluted: "Uncle Master, I would like to borrow these three books, is it possible?"

The old man opened his eyes, briefly glanced at the book in Qin Fengming's hand, and said calmly: "Each book is five spiritual stones, limited to two months."

Qin Fengming quickly took out fifteen spiritual stones and handed them to the old man respectfully.

The old man watched Qin Fengming leave with a strange look in his eyes, as if he had something to say, but in the end he did not speak.

Returning to his cave, he spent ten days studying the "Preliminary Interpretation of Formation" and his insights, and finally made rubbings on the jade slips.

Then, he spent more than ten days carefully reading "Travel Notes of Qingyuan Continent", and rubbing the parts of interest on the jade slips, and then returned the three volumes to Jishu Pavilion.

Through "Qingyuan Continental Travels", Qin Fengming finally had a basic understanding of the continent where the Liang Kingdom was located. After reading the entire book, he was shocked and stunned for a long time.

Qingyuan Continent is the continent where Daliang Kingdom is located, and its territory is extremely vast.

It is said that if a monk at the peak of his Qi Gathering Stage were to control a magic weapon and fly at full speed without considering the mana, it would take thousands of years to penetrate the entire continent.

Such a large territory was something Qin Fengming had never thought of.

The book even mentions that Qingyuan Continent is only a small part of the entire world. How big this world is is not specified in the travel notes.

Although there was no introduction to other places, the Qingyuan Continent was still explained in detail.

Qingyuan Continent has two superpowers, namely: Deqing Empire and Yuanfeng Empire; they are located in the north and south of Qingyuan Continent respectively, Deqing Empire is in the north of Qingyuan Continent, and Yuanfeng Empire is in the south of Qingyuan Continent.

There are thirteen small countries interspersed between these two big countries, each of which is dependent on the two superpowers. Although several small countries have wars from time to time, these two superpowers rarely participate in them. This is because the royal families of these two superpowers have connections with the world of immortality.

Inextricably linked.

Both of these two superpowers have several super sects with many internalized infant monks. According to the book, there may be legendary old monsters from the Convergence Period among them.

For immortal cultivators, the most important thing is to improve their own cultivation, and they have no interest in wars between countries.

Those small countries sometimes have conflicts for some reasons, but they rarely worry about annihilation because they are supported by superpowers.

The travel notes also gave a brief introduction to the super sects in the two superpowers, which opened Qin Fengming's eyes and shocked him. At the same time, it also made him feel extremely insignificant, let alone a transformed infant, a monk in the realm of gathering, just a building

Brother Ji, they are all powerful monks that he admires very much.

Putting away the travel notes, he carefully studied the "Preliminary Interpretation of Formations" printed on the jade slip. Although it did not introduce any advanced formations, for Qin Fengming, it felt like he could see the sun through the clouds.

I also have a preliminary understanding of why a formation disk with a few formation flags can form a formation with huge power.

"Preliminary Explanation of Formations" only introduces several elementary formations, and they are the most useless formations. But Qin Fengming is still eager to study and refine them in practice.

After careful comparison, a set of magic array called Spirit Gathering Array fell into his eyes.

This array can gather the spiritual energy in the air at one point through the array for the monks to absorb. This reminds him of his mysterious gourd. That gourd can absorb his own spiritual energy, such as the gourd can directly absorb the spirit gathering array.

Gathering spiritual power is an excellent thing.
